Key Highlights: Mexico Electronics Exports Trade Data

  • Mexico is a global hub for electronics manufacturing and export, especially to North America.
  • Strong integration with the US supply chain under trade agreements like USMCA.
  • Key export products include semiconductors, TVs, computers, mobile components, and wiring harnesses.
  • Major electronics clusters are located in Baja California, Jalisco, Chihuahua, and Nuevo León.
  • Competitive advantages: low-cost skilled labor, proximity to the U.S., and advanced manufacturing ecosystems.
  • High demand driven by automotive electronics, consumer electronics, and industrial automation sectors.
  • Increasing investment from global tech giants relocating production closer to the U.S. (nearshoring trend).
  • Supported by robust logistics infrastructure including ports, rail, and cross-border trucking.
  • HS Codes commonly involved: 8471 (computers), 8517 (telecom equipment), 8528 (monitors/TVs).
  • Mexico ranks among the top electronics exporters globally, especially in Latin America.

Mexico Electronics Exports Trade Data: Trade Overview

Mexico’s electronics export industry has emerged as one of the most dynamic and strategically positioned sectors within the global trade ecosystem. Leveraging its geographic proximity to the United States, Mexico has become a preferred manufacturing and export base for multinational electronics companies seeking cost efficiency and supply chain resilience. The country exports a wide range of electronic goods, including computers (HS Code 8471), telecommunications equipment (HS Code 8517), integrated circuits (HS Code 8542), and televisions (HS Code 8528). The presence of established manufacturing clusters, particularly in regions like Guadalajara—often referred to as the “Silicon Valley of Mexico”—has further strengthened its export capabilities. Additionally, favorable trade agreements such as the United States-Mexico-Canada Agreement (USMCA) provide tariff advantages and simplified cross-border trade, making Mexico a competitive player in global electronics exports.

Market Trends and Benefits of Import Export Industry:

In terms of trends, the Mexico electronics export sector is witnessing rapid transformation driven by nearshoring, digitalization, and rising global demand for smart devices and automotive electronics. Companies are increasingly shifting operations from Asia to Mexico to reduce lead times and mitigate geopolitical risks. This shift is significantly boosting export volumes and attracting foreign direct investment into the sector. Moreover, the growing adoption of Industry 4.0 technologies, such as automation and IoT, is enhancing production efficiency and export quality standards. The benefits of Mexico’s electronics export industry extend beyond economic growth—they include job creation, technological advancement, and increased participation in global value chains. For import-export businesses, Mexico offers a reliable sourcing destination with high-quality products, streamlined logistics, and strong compliance with international trade standards. As global demand for electronics continues to rise, Mexico is well-positioned to expand its footprint and maintain its status as a leading electronics exporter.
